Best Times to Visit Big Stone National Wildlife Refuge

When should you plan your Vacation Rentals stay?

Choosing the optimal time to visit this destination ensures you experience its natural beauty and tranquility at their best, whether you're seeking peaceful escapes or outdoor adventures in the area.

Peak Season Highlights

summer
Late Spring to Early Summer (May to June)

During this time, the area comes alive with active wildlife and blooming flora, making it ideal for birdwatching and enjoying nature's vibrancy.

Average Temperature Daytime: around 70-80°F - Nighttime: 50-60°F
autumn
Early Fall (September to October)

This period offers stunning fall foliage views and a quieter atmosphere, perfect for exploring the region's natural beauty.

Average Temperature Daytime: 65-75°F - Nighttime: 40-50°F

Off-Season Highlights

image
Winter (December to February)

The cold season transforms the area into a peaceful winter landscape, ideal for winter sports enthusiasts or those seeking solitude.

Average Temperature Daytime: 20-30°F - Nighttime: 10-20°F
image
Mid to Late Summer (July to August)

While warm, this time can be busier due to tourist influx; however, it remains a good opportunity for those wanting to avoid the spring crowds.

Average Temperature Daytime: 80-85°F - Nighttime: 55-65°F
